SBO thru Internet - License Server error 60070-15

Former Member
0 Kudos

I set a static ip on my router with NAT. I successfully connected and saw the list of companies or DBs but it prompted me for the License Server IP. I re-enter the static IP but still showing the error msg

"connection to the Licence server failed (60070-15)"

Need any assistance on this matter.

Thank you in advance

Dear,

Please first refer to note 1142479, which explains the

license server connection failed error; caused by

stoping TAO NT Naming service.

Is the TAO NT Naming Service in server stoped when the error

happens in customer's environment?

(To access this service, right-click the My Computer

icon and choose Manage -> Services.)

If the TAO Naming Service is stopped, please right click the

TAO NT Naming Service,then open the properties

and set it to auto-restart.

If the TAO NT Naming Service is started then the issue may caused by

other root causes.

1- Please check if the ports 30000 and 30001 is not blocking (Check the

SAP note 960879)

2- Check if have any kind of anti-virus and firewall run between server and client.If so,is there any log when error happens?

3- Please remove and re-install the server tools again.

4- Please enable the write to log function in the setting of license manu and check is there any related information loged when error happens.

5- Please check is there any related information logged in windows eventlog when error happens.

Hi Raleigh,

Please check the connection between the client and the server, the server must listen on 30000 and 30001 TCP/IP ports. These ports are in use via the license communication.

We have a client with network address translation (NAT) and the client computers will not be able to connect to the SAP B1 license server.

The only way to resolve this was to abandon NAT - you might want to look into that.

Hi Raleigh,

The communication with the license server in 2005 version is not based on permanent port but it changes dynamically. Therefore, the license server should not be "protected" by any firewall. We recommend installing the license service behind the NAT firewall.
